Based on 221 recent sales, the median property price is £250,000 (about £276 per square foot) in Wakefield Rural area, with individual transactions ranging from £50,000 up to £1,200,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 72 | £387,500 | £306 |
| Semi-Detached | 100 | £234,408 | £267 |
| Terraced | 40 | £187,000 | £261 |
| Flats | 9 | £135,000 | £187 |

Postcode WF4 3LD is located in a major urban area, within the Wakefield Rural ward of Wakefield in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Kettlethorpe & Chapelthorpe area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 87.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 23%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Kettlethorpe & Chapelthorpe is £47,083 per year. The nearest station is Sandal and Agbrigg, about 2.7 miles away. There are 4 primary and no secondary schools in the area.
Kettlethorpe & Chapelthorpe has a high level of deprivation, ranked at position 7,723 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 24% most deprived areas in England.
